Which statement about Pap smear guidelines is accurate?

Explanation:
Cervical cancer screening guidelines emphasize starting in early adulthood, with the typical starting point around age 21. How often you screen isn’t the same for everyone; guidelines differ by age and by whether HPV testing is used, so the interval can be every few years rather than annually. Vaccination against HPV lowers risk, but it doesn’t eliminate the need for screening, since vaccination doesn’t cover all cancer-causing HPV types. So the statement that you begin screening around age 21, that the frequency varies by guideline, and that HPV vaccination is recommended fits best with current guidance.
